
16. Buy Discounted Stocks
The stock market plummeted thousands of points in an extremely short time, going to its lowest point since The Great Depression. If you have the ability to invest in stocks, now might be the time to do it. A financial advisor can give you advice on which companies to invest in. Or you could do some research online and find some information about what companies are currently undervalued.

Try to look at companies that are doing things to survive the crisis in the long-term. Ask yourself what businesses will still be around, even in “worst-case scenario”. Also do some research on the quarterly earnings reports to see which companies have been on the brink of bankruptcy for some time.
